Local Attractions

Three unmissable attractions sit within a 10-minute walk of the guesthouse:

  • Jiufen Old Street: Starting right at your doorstep, this winding stone lane is lined with wooden shophouses selling iconic street food, from crispy taro balls to grilled squid and handmade pineapple cakes. Duck into hidden teahouses to sip local oolong while looking out over misty hills and the sea.
  • Golden Waterfall: A 10-minute downhill walk from the guesthouse, this rust-hued waterfall gets its unique color from natural mineral deposits left by Jiufen’s gold-mining history. It flows directly into the ocean, creating a striking contrast of golden rock and deep blue water that’s perfect for photographs.

13. Shengping Theater: A five-minute walk from 九份山旅, this restored 1930s cinema preserves the glamour of Jiufen’s gold rush heyday. You can wander the vintage lobby, catch screenings of classic Taiwanese films, and explore the small exhibits on the town’s historic entertainment scene.

Travel Tips

Since there is no on-site parking at 九份山旅, it’s best to reach Jiufen via public transport: take a train to Ruifang Station, then catch a 15-minute local bus up the hill to Jiufen’s Old Street stop. Wear comfortable walking shoes—Jiufen’s lanes are steep and uneven, and the guesthouse’s stair access requires a bit of stamina. Jiufen is often foggy and cool even in summer, so pack a light jacket and layers, and arrive by mid-afternoon to beat the crowds of day-trippers before they head down the mountain.
